Understand Dental Implants



When considering oral implants, it is necessary to recognize what they're and just how they function. Essentially, dental implants are synthetic tooth roots made from titanium, created to sustain replacement teeth or bridges.

These implants are operatively placed into your jawbone, where they fuse with the bone with time, offering a strong and stable structure for your new teeth.

The process begins with an examination, where your dental professional reviews your oral health and wellness and reviews your objectives. If you're an appropriate candidate, the dental expert will certainly wage the medical placement of the dental implant.

During this procedure, they'll make a little cut in your gum, pierce right into the jawbone, and place the dental implant. After this, a recovery period of several months is essential for the implant to incorporate with the bone.

As soon as recovered, you'll return for the placement of the abutment, which attaches the implant to the crown. Lastly, the tailor-made crown is attached, finishing the remediation.

Recognizing these actions helps you really feel extra prepared and educated as you embark on your dental implant trip. Keep in mind, having realistic assumptions and asking concerns can dramatically ease any type of problems you may have.

Gather Case History



Gathering your medical history is a vital action in getting ready for a dental implant examination. Your dentist will certainly need a comprehensive understanding of your general wellness to establish if you're an ideal prospect for implants.

Beginning by noting any kind of existing medications, including over the counter medicines and supplements. Also, note any type of allergies, particularly to anesthesia or anti-biotics, as this information can significantly influence your therapy strategy.

Next off, think about your medical problems. Conditions like diabetes mellitus, heart problem, or autoimmune conditions can impact recovery and the success of implants. Be sincere regarding your smoking cigarettes habits, as tobacco use can complicate recovery.

If you have actually had previous dental work or surgeries, consisting of removals or grafts, take down those also. Bring any pertinent medical records or examination results to your consultation, as these can offer your dental expert with beneficial insights.

Lastly, take into consideration household case history. If any kind of relatives have experienced complications with dental procedures, sharing this information can aid your dental professional evaluate prospective dangers.

Prepare Concerns to Ask



Preparing a listing of concerns to ask during your oral implant assessment can considerably boost your understanding of the treatment and what to expect. Beginning by asking about the dental practitioner's experience with implants. Ask the amount of procedures they've executed and their success prices. This will give you self-confidence in their competence.



Next, go over the kinds of implants offered and which one might be best for you. You ought to also ask about the products used and their durability.

Don't fail to remember to inquire about the anesthesia options and any kind of discomfort you could experience during the procedure. Clearing up the prices involved and what your insurance policy covers is vital, so be sure to inquire about layaway plan if needed.

Also, ask about the recovery process and what kind of aftercare is required.

Lastly, ask about any potential threats or difficulties connected with dental implants. Having your questions prepared will empower you to make enlightened decisions about your dental wellness and ensure you feel comfy moving on.
